Найти в Дзене

Как прервать цикл 1с

В 1С прервать цикл можно с помощью оператора Прервать. Этот оператор используется внутри цикла и приводит к его немедленному завершению. Управление передается оператору, следующему за ключевым словом КонецЦикла. В этом примере цикл будет выполняться до тех пор, пока значение переменной Счетчик не достигнет 5. Когда это произойдет, оператор Прервать завершит выполнение цикла, и программа перейдет к выполнению оператора Сообщить("Цикл завершен."). Пример 2: Прерывание цикла Пока Пример 3: Прерывание цикла Цикл
Оглавление

В 1С прервать цикл можно с помощью оператора Прервать. Этот оператор используется внутри цикла и приводит к его немедленному завершению. Управление передается оператору, следующему за ключевым словом КонецЦикла.

Пример использования оператора "Прервать"

В этом примере цикл будет выполняться до тех пор, пока значение переменной Счетчик не достигнет 5. Когда это произойдет, оператор Прервать завершит выполнение цикла, и программа перейдет к выполнению оператора Сообщить("Цикл завершен.").

Важные моменты

  • Оператор Прервать завершает выполнение только текущего цикла. Если цикл находится внутри другого цикла, то выполнение внешнего цикла продолжится.
  • Оператор Прервать можно использовать внутри циклов разных типов, таких как Для, Пока и Цикл.

Дополнительные примеры

Пример 1: Прерывание цикла Для

-2

Пример 2: Прерывание цикла Пока

-3

Пример 3: Прерывание цикла Цикл

-4

Рекомендации

  • Используйте оператор Прервать осторожно, чтобы не нарушить логику работы программы.
  • Перед использованием оператора Прервать убедитесь, что он действительно необходим.
  • Старайтесь избегать использования оператора Прервать внутри вложенных циклов, так как это может затруднить понимание кода.